【mcu介绍】MCU(Microcontroller Unit,微控制器)是一种集成了处理器核心、内存、输入/输出接口和外围设备的单片计算机。它广泛应用于各种嵌入式系统中,如家电、汽车电子、工业控制、消费电子产品等。由于其体积小、功耗低、成本低、功能集成度高等特点,MCU在现代电子设备中扮演着重要角色。
MCU的核心在于其内部的中央处理单元(CPU),它可以执行指令、处理数据,并与外部设备进行通信。此外,MCU通常还包含闪存或ROM用于存储程序代码,RAM用于临时数据存储,以及定时器、ADC(模数转换器)、DAC(数模转换器)、PWM(脉宽调制)等功能模块,以满足不同应用场景的需求。
在选择MCU时,需要考虑多个因素,包括处理能力、存储容量、外设数量、功耗、封装形式、开发工具支持等。不同的MCU适用于不同的应用领域,例如:
- 8位MCU:适合简单的控制任务,如家电遥控器、传感器节点等。
- 16位MCU:在性能和成本之间取得平衡,常用于工业控制和汽车电子。
- 32位MCU:具有更高的处理能力和更丰富的外设,适用于复杂的应用,如智能仪表、物联网设备等。
- ARM Cortex-M系列:是当前市场上非常流行的32位MCU架构,广泛应用于各种嵌入式系统。
以下是一些常见的MCU品牌及其典型产品:
品牌 | 系列 | 特点 | 适用领域 |
STMicroelectronics | STM32 | 高性能、低功耗、丰富外设 | 工业控制、消费电子、物联网 |
NXP | LPC、Kinetis | 高可靠性、多核支持 | 汽车电子、工业自动化 |
Microchip | PIC | 易于学习、性价比高 | 教学、基础控制 |
Texas Instruments | MSP430 | 超低功耗 | 传感器、医疗设备 |
Espressif | ESP32 | Wi-Fi/蓝牙双模、高性能 | 物联网、智能家居 |
总的来说,MCU作为嵌入式系统的核心部件,正随着技术的发展不断演进,为各种智能化设备提供强大的支持。无论是简单的控制任务还是复杂的实时系统,MCU都能找到合适的解决方案。